Honestly, I don't think any of these racquets would be good for someone just starting out. They headsize and weight might be too much of a challenge. That is not to say that a beginner can't use a control racquet, but that I would recommend getting a racquet that is 102-110 sq. in. depending on your hand-eye coordination. Also, a racquet that is neutral balance or headlight but that is over 10.4 oz strung with a lower swing weight and medium flex can be a very good racquet for someone who is athletic but is new to the game. In these cases, I tend to recommend something like the Wilson BLX Blade Team or Head Youtek Radical Oversize. Get 4 demos and try them before buying. The larger head-size but the control of the frame will make it a good racquet to grow into.
